CVE-2026-6865Network attack vector

Authenticated sensitive-file access via path traversal

Published May 12, 2026 · Updated May 12, 2026

Path traversal in EasyLogic T150 11.06.31 and earlier and Saitel DP 11.06.36 and earlier allows remote authenticated users to access sensitive files. Server-side file path processing mishandles user-supplied input and fails to confine resolution to an authorized directory; no endpoint or handler is disclosed. Low-privilege network credentials and service reachability are required, and exploitation discloses sensitive files and permits limited file writes.
